The Square, Tallaght

Electro Automation have supplied and installed a 27-lane car-parking system for The Square Tallaght. There is also a fully comprehensive maintenance and technical support contract in place.

Originally a shopping centre car-park which did not charge for parking, the massive growth in the Tallaght area which included the construction of the AMNCH Hospital and the opening of the Red Luas Line meant that The Square had to quickly address their customers’ parking concerns.


After discussing the client’s full requirements at Project Management stage, it was decided that the Zeag Orion XR parking solution best met their needs and budget constraints.

 

The scope of the works included the supply, install and maintenance of the following equipment:

  • 14 paystations
  • 14 PE entry lanes
  • 13 PA exit lanes
  • 27 traffic barriers
  • 1 central unit intercom
  • 1 cashier station
  • 1 ZMS work station and server
  • 12 CCTV cameras
  • 5 Variable Messaging Signs (VMS)

The Square Shopping Centre required a robust, reliable and proven system to ensure the efficient flow of traffic in and around their busy car parks. 

With enormous quantities of cars using the site each day it was essential that the system facilitated the removal of parking violations, while at the same time ensured that traffic could flow freely while using the system.

 

Our Installation Supervisor worked closely and successfully with the main contractor and Centre management to complete the transition from uncontrolled to controlled parking. 

 

This involved the installation and commissioning of the Zeag Orion XR Parking system, Commend intercom system, a CCTV system covering all lanes and pay stations, a Variable Message system on the approach roads and user training of the various elements.

 

After studying the full range of Maintenance Contracts Electro Automation offer, The Square felt that a Platinum Plus contract would be best suited to their needs and budget. This contract offers unlimited free of charge callouts 24 hours, 7 days a week. All equipment failures are covered for both parts and labour - subject to normal Terms & Conditions

 

Each part of the car-parking system is serviced every month, with the CCTV cameras scheduled for two services per year.

 

Our engineers and technical support unit can connect into the system from our Headquarters if needed, and provide full diagnostics and reporting remotely. In the unlikely event of a repair not being completed, the faulty equipment is removed from site and a loan unit is supplied free of charge.
